GLOBAL YAOI IMPRINT SUBLIME ANNOUNCES
WORLDWIDE DEBUT OF YONEZOU NEKOTA’S
NEW SERIES DON’T BE CRUEL

A 2-in-1 Omnibus Edition Of A Highly Requested Manga Series About Classroom Hijinks Between A Playboy And His Studious Classmate Launches This Summer

San Francisco, CA, June 22, 2016SuBLime, the leading global English-language yaoi manga (graphic novel) publisher, announces the launch of adored creator Yonezou Nekota’s series DON’T BE CRUEL.

This newest title to join the SuBLime catalog is rated ‘M’ for Mature Readers and is now available as a 2-in-1 omnibus edition in print and digital. The print edition carriesan MSRP of $16.99 U.S. / $19.99 CAN. The digital version will carry an MSRP of $7.99 U.S. and offers readers two methods of digital access to the volume on SuBLimeManga.com – a DRM-free downloadable PDF that is viewable on any enabled eReader device and computer as well as via the online manga viewer found on the SuBLime website.

In DON’T BE CRUEL, playboy Maya catches studious Nemugasa cheating on a test and, to ensure his silence, blackmails him into doing whatever Maya wants. Twice a week, Nemugasa must go to Maya’s room for some steamy action, but as dense and oblivious as Nemugasa is, he fails to notice Maya’s true feelings for him. With college entrance exams around the corner, Nemugasa must focus on his studies, but Maya won’t stop distracting him, causing him to finally snap! Can a relationship built on blackmail ever become something more?

Yonezou Nekota enjoys a dedicated fan base that has looked forward to the release of DON’T BE CRUEL in English, and we are very happy to launch this highly requested series in expanded 2-in-1 omnibus editions,” says SuBLime Editor, Jennifer LeBlanc. “What begins as a case of emotional extortion quickly escalates, and readers will enjoy all of the torrid drama that ensues.”

DON’T BE CRUEL is Yonezou Nekota’s first English-language release, but she is already renowned in yaoi fan circles for her title Mousou Elektel. She is also a prolific doujinshi (independent comics) creator. Fans can find out more about Yonezou Nekota at her website, http://komeya.sub.jp/, or her Twitter page, @yonekozoh.

DYNAMITE ENTERTAINMENT RELEASES A "TOUCHING" TALE
OF A HORRIFYING FUTURE IN THE GREAT DIVIDE



June 21, 2016, Mt. Laurel, NJ: Dynamite Entertainment's line of creator-driven titles featuring today's top talent continues to grow with Grumpy Cat and Smuggling Spirits writer Ben Fisher's The Great Divide! Created with his Smuggling Spirits collaborator, artist Adam Markiewicz, The Great Divide paints a terrifying picture of life without human contact, for fear of a bloody demise!

In The Great Divide, humanity awakens in the near future to the horrifying reality that the faintest touch from another's skin results in agonizing death. The survivors isolate themselves, many driven mad by fragments of memories absorbed from the dead. But when a pair of thieves stumbles upon the means to save their species, they learn not everyone is eager to see the old world order restored…

"The Great Divide is set in a desperate, dangerous world. But at the heart of the book are two people struggling with the same basic question we all have: how do we find real connection with each other?" says author Ben Fisher. "That blend of high concept action and deeply personal motivation is fertile ground for storytelling, and Dynamite is the perfect platform for this series."

"After working with Ben on our lighthearted Grumpy Cat comic series, we wanted to offer him a chance to do something of his own creation," says Dynamite CEO/Publisher, Nick Barrucci. "When he turned in the pitch for The Great Divide, it was exactly the kind of thrilling horror-fueled science fiction we love here at Dynamite. It's destined to be one of our standout original series of the year!"

Each issue of The Great Divide will also contain unique bonus digital content. The first issue will include a download code for "Teowawki," a song about a doomsday prepper on a first date, written and performed by Ben Fisher.

A faux "Public Service Announcement" promotional poster warning of the health risks caused by the "Divide" will be included in Diamond shipments as advanced advertising for the series and additionally released in digital format.

DYNAMITE ENTERTAINMENT REWARDS COLLECTORS WITH
THE BEST OF VAMPIRELLA MAGAZINE ART EDITION

Original Art From the Heyday of Horror Comics,
Beautifully Bound in Original Storyboard Size This September!



June 21, 2016, Mt. Laurel, NJ: Following the widely celebrated release of Jose Gonzalez's Vampirella Art Edition, Dynamite Entertainment is proud to announce the next treasure trove of classic horror: The Best of Vampirella Magazine Art Edition.

Terror aficionados, prepare to be bewitched and bedeviled! The Best of Vampirella Magazine is a glorious hardcover treasury of actual storyboard artwork from the heyday of horror comics, scanned in high-resolution color to capture the look of the artwork as originally illustrated, with all blue lines, corrections, editorial notes, and other distinctive creative elements intact. Each scan is then printed on heavy stock paper to give readers a more realistic experience of what it would be like to hold actual storyboard pages.

Over a dozen mesmerizing tales appear in their entirety, stories ranging from Vampirella Magazine #9 (January 1971) to issue #112 (October 1979). Featuring contributions from such comic luminaries as Jeffrey Jones, Auraleon, Jose Ortiz, and Luis Bermejo (to name a few), this hardcover Art Edition preserves and celebrates the meticulous skill and hard work of the artists that defined the horror comic medium!

"Vampirella is not only one of the cornerstones of Dynamite's publishing line, but the history of horror comics," says Dynamite CEO/Publisher, Nick Barrucci. "After the reception we received with our collection of Jose Gonzalez's iconic pages, we knew we had to pay tribute to some of our other favorite art from Vampirella's classic Warren publications. We wholeheartedly believe that The Best of Vampirella Magazine is an essential addition to every horror comic fan's bookshelf... that is, if they have a bookshelf big enough for it!"

This beautiful oversized edition features over 150 pages of art, and includes the following Vampirella Magazine stories in their completion:

Vampirella Magazine #9: "Vampi's Feary Tales: Lilith" by Nicola Cuti (w) and Jeffrey Jones (a)
Vampirella Magazine #17: "Lover of the Bayou" by Jan Strnad (w) and Luis Roca (a)
Vampirella Magazine #20: "Love is No Game" by Steve Skeates (w) and Luis Garcia (a)
Vampirella Magazine #20: "Vengeance, Brother, Vengeance" by Greg Potter (w) and Luis Dominguez (a)
Vampirella Magazine #21: "The Vampiress Stalks the Castle This Night" by Don McGregor (w) and Felix Mas (a)
Vampirella Magazine #24: "Middle-Am" by Steve Skeates (w) and Esteban Maroto (a)
Vampirella Magazine #25: "The Dead Howl at Midnight" by W. Eaton (w) and Jose Bea (a)
Vampirella Magazine #39: "The French Coagulation" by Carl Wessler (w), Gerry Boudreau (w), and Luis Bermejo (a)
Vampirella Magazine #39: "The Head-Hunter of London" by John Michael Butterworth (w) and Leopoldo Sanchez (a)
Vampirella Magazine #39: "Sultan of 42nd Street" by Carl Wessler (w), Gerry Boudreau (w), and Felix Mas (a)
Vampirella Magazine #41: "The Wickford Witches" by Gerry Boudreau (w) and Jose Ortiz (a)
Vampirella Magazine #45: "The Winter of Their Discontent" by Gerry Boudreau (w) and Isidro Mones (a)
Vampirella Magazine #47: "Gamal and the Cockatrice" by Bruce Bezaire (w) and Auraleon (a)
Vampirella Magazine #53: "The Last Man Syndrome" by Roger McKenzie (w) and Ramon Torrents (a)
Vampirella Magazine #82: "Prey for the Wolf" by Cary Bates (w) and Brian Lewis (a)

The Best of Vampirella Magazine Art Edition will be solicited in Diamond Comic Distributors' July 2016 Previews catalog, the premiere source of merchandise for the comic book specialty market, and slated for release in September priced at $150.00. THE WOMEN OF DYNAMITE STATUE LINE EXPANDS TO INCLUDE
THE LIMITED EDITION PURGATORI "BLACK & WHITE" AND
JUNGLE GIRL "DIAMOND EYE" VARIANTS



June 21, 2016, Mt. Laurel, NJ: Building upon the excitement for the all-new Women of Dynamite statue line, as well as the recent debut of the line's first statue (based on horror icon Vampirella), Dynamite is proud to announce the expansion of the series with Limited Edition variant statues, based on the popular comic book characters Purgatori and Jungle Girl. Extremely limited in number, the Purgatori "Black & White" Statue and Jungle Girl "Diamond Eye" Statue will provide fans with rare and visually unique collectibles for purchase beginning in September 2016.

The Women of Dynamite: Purgatori Limited Edition "Black & White" Statue:

Only 49 of these beautiful black-and-white statues exist in the whole world! The extremely Limited Edition Purgatori statue, based on the work of comics sensation Michael Turner and sculpted by the ever-talented Jason Smith, features the stark contrast of light and darkness, with just a touch of deep red to highlight our villainess's classic look. Hand-painted on cold-cast porcelain, the Purgatori statue stands approximately 12" in height (14" to the tip of her wings) with a 6" base. This rare variant edition of the Women of Dynamite: Purgatori statue comes packaged in a four-color box with a hand-numbered Certificate of Authenticity. This lady's killer contours make an alluring addition to every hardcore fiend's collection!

The Women of Dynamite: Jungle Girl Limited Edition "Diamond Eye" Statue:

Only 99 of these gorgeous "Diamond Eye" edition statues exist in the whole world! The extremely Limited Edition Jungle Girl statue, based on the work of comics sensation Frank Cho and sculpted by the ever-talented Jason Smith, features comic book sensation Jana in all her primal glory... with a twinkle in her eye, courtesy of jewel placement on her perfectly sculpted face. Hand-painted on cold-cast porcelain, the Jungle Girl statue stands approximately 12" in height with a 6" base. This rare variant edition of the Women of Dynamite: Jungle Girl statue comes packaged in a four-color box with a hand-numbered Certificate of Authenticity. The jungle has never been hotter, thanks to this captivating statue!

"When we were planning our Women of Dynamite line of statues, we knew we had to do something really special with Purgatori and Jungle Girl," says Dynamite CEO and Publisher, Nick Barrucci. "Horror lovers and collectible enthusiasts have expressed such anticipation for the new line in light of our debut, Vampirella. Dynamite and the skillful team at The Brewing Factory want to reward their excitement with special variations, giving them several options for how to best display their favorite femme fatales."

Dynamite's Limited Edition statues retail for $249.99 apiece. The Women of Dynamite: Purgatori Limited Edition "Black & White" Statue and Women of Dynamite: Jungle Girl Limited Edition "Diamond Eye" Statue can be found solicited in the July-dated edition of Diamond's Previews catalog, corresponding to a release date in September 2016. eigoMANGA's Original Animation Videos Stream On Steam

San Francisco, California (June 22, 2016) – eigoMANGA has begun streaming English-subtitled original animation videos ("OAV") on Steam, a leading interactive content delivery platform by software company, Valve Corporation.

eigoMANGA has released two OAV titles on Steam. 'DEMIAN' is a story about an elite government team that pilots a five into one super robot fighting force. They are called to take down their robot's creator who is now a terrorist. The Steam page for 'DEMIAN' is http://store.steampowered.com/app/470240/

'Break Ups' is a slice of life story about a young couple with an on-and-off relationship. They stumble upon a time machine that takes them back to several periods in their lives as a couple. The Steam page for 'Break Ups' is http://store.steampowered.com/app/470250/

'DEMIAN' and 'Break Ups' are produced by Goingdol, an animation studio based in Seoul, South Korea. Both OAV titles are available on Steam as a bundle called the 'Goindol Bundle'. The Steam page for the 'Goindol Bundle' is http://store.steampowered.com/bundle/734/

Sony Pictures’ 'Don't Breathe’, Fred Dekker, Doug Benson, & 25th Anniversary screening of Bill & Ted’s Bogus Journey Among Highlights Of Third Annual Bruce Campbell Horror Film Festival Lineup, August 18-21 In Chicago

Presented by STARZ Original Series ‘Ash vs. Evil Dead', in conjunction with Wizard World Comic Con

bruce_campbell_2011-lo.JPGROSEMONT, Ill., June 22, 2016 — Bruce Campbell’s Horror Film Festival, presented by Starz and their hit original series Ash vs. Evil Dead, returns for its third annual festivities on August 18-21, in conjunction with Wizard World Chicago. Today, the Festival announced highlights of the groovy lineup, sponsored by Shudder and Bloody-Disgusting.com, featuring the critically acclaimed opening night nail-biter Don’t Breathe, directed by Fede Alvarez; a salute to genre hero Fred Dekker; an epic event featuring comedian Doug Benson; and a 25th anniversary celebration of the most excellent sequel, Bill & Ted’s Bogus Journey (originally titled Bill & Ted Go To Hell).
"I'm thrilled to bring our annual horror festival back to the Windy City for the third year," said Campbell. "There were some wicked cool flicks this year and we went after the cream of the crop. If you love all things horror, check out our lineup!"

The festivities will kick off on Thursday, August 18, with the opening night film Don't Breathe, the highly anticipated shocker from director-producer-writer Fede Alvarez (Evil Dead ) and produced by Sam

Raimi & Rob Tapert. Alvarez will be in attendance. This will reunite Campbell with Alvarez, who directed the successful 2013 remake of Evil Dead . Sony Pictures is set to release Don’t Breathe on August 26, 2016.

The inaugural "Groovy as Hell" award will be presented to writer/director Fred Dekker (Fox’s upcoming The Predator). The awards ceremony will consist of a 30th anniversary screening of the cult classic Night of The Creeps and a very special screening of The Monster Squad with actors Andre Gower (Sean) & Ryan Lambert (Rudy) also in attendance.

Festival favorite Doug Benson ( Doug Loves Movies, Chromic-Con, Super High Me) will be in town for a very special ‘Doug Benson Movie Interruption’ of Army of Darkness, with guest interrupter Bruce Campbell ! The two will sit in the front row together with a selection of mystery comedy guests, and say whatever hilarious stuff that pops into their head. A limited amount of single tickets for this event are on sale now!

BCHFF is thrilled to present a 25th anniversary celebration of everyone’s favorite time-traveling metalhead slackers, a screening of Bill & Ted's Bogus Journey with director Peter Hewitt in attendance! Additional guests for this screening will be announced at a later date.

The festival will also mark the World Premieres of Found Footage 3D, the long-awaited satirical horror film produced by Kim Henkel (The Texas Chainsaw Massacre ) and directed by Steven DeGennaro, and Show Yourself, a haunting & remarkable genre-bending feature debut from Billy Ray Brewton (subject of the wonderful award-winning 2014 documentary Skanks, and programmer for Slamdance Film Festival).

Fans in the region will also experience the Chicago premieres of:
     The Greasy Strangler - The most hilariously disturbing film of the year. From Elijah Wood's Spectrevision, Drafthouse Films, & Ant Timpson.
     Here Alone  - Winner of the 2016 Tribeca Audience Award.
     Abattoir - From Darren Bousman, the director of Saw 2, 3, 4, Repo: The Genetic Opera, Mother’s Day, and The Devil’s Carnival. Darren will be in attendance to present the film.
     Pet - The SXSW hit starring Dominic Monaghan (Lord of The Rings Trilogy).
     I am Not a Serial Killer - Starring Christopher Lloyd in yet another career defining performance.
     Beyond The Gates - Winner of the midnight audience award at Los Angeles Film Festival.

The Bruce Campbell Horror Film Festival jury this year includes a few dignitaries well-known to horror fans: Tom Holland (writer/director, Fright Night, Child's Play); Barry Bostwick (Rocky Horror Picture Show ); Cerina Vincent ( Cabin Fever); and Zach Hagen (producer, He Never Died).

“It’s been another astonishing year for horror cinema”, said festival director, Josh Goldbloom. “I’m overwhelmed by the amount of talent & creativity working in this field. Their contributions are innovative, visionary, beautifully unnerving, defiantly weird, and of course, bloody as all hell. This year’s festival is a showcase of all the many reasons why genre film & its fans are the best in the world.

Many additional titles, surprises and guest announcements will be announced over the coming month, along with a very special closing night feature, presented by Bloody-Disgusting.com.

Festival badges are $100, and are on sale now at www.bchff.com! Limited single tickets sales for screenings will go on sale Wednesday, July 6th.

The festival and all screenings will be held at the Carmike Muvico Rosemont 18.
